我的Python学习之路(8)

今日学习内容

1.了解Python程序设计思维,尝试进行系统化、模块化的程序设计
2.学习Python第三方库的安装方法,学习pip指令安装、集成化安装、文件安装等方法
3.了解os库的基本功能,尝试编写代码使得Python程序自动化地安装第三方库

第三方库安装方法

pip指令法

win+r打开运行,输入cmd打开控制台命令窗口,输入命令pip -h打开pip命令的帮助列表,如下图所示:
我的Python学习之路(8)_第1张图片
图中第一条command命令就是第三方库的安装方法,使用命令pip install 第三方库名即可安装第三方库

集成安装法

使用Anaconda开发工具,支持近800个第三方库,包含多个主流的工具,适合数据计算领域的开发,点我访问网址

文件安装法

某些第三方库可能无法直接安装在计算机上,需要先编译为可执行文件再安装,这时需要我们访问这个网址,搜索我们要安装的第三方库名,下载对应版本的文件,再使用pip命令安装即可(这是加州大学一个教授的个人网站,他集成了一些特殊的第三方库,方便程序员下载安装)

OS库的使用

路径操作

我的Python学习之路(8)_第2张图片
我的Python学习之路(8)_第3张图片
我的Python学习之路(8)_第4张图片
我的Python学习之路(8)_第5张图片
我的Python学习之路(8)_第6张图片
我的Python学习之路(8)_第7张图片

进程管理

我的Python学习之路(8)_第8张图片
我的Python学习之路(8)_第9张图片
我的Python学习之路(8)_第10张图片

环境参数

我的Python学习之路(8)_第11张图片
我的Python学习之路(8)_第12张图片
我的Python学习之路(8)_第13张图片

第三方库自动安装脚本

效果图

我的Python学习之路(8)_第14张图片

源代码

#第三方库安装脚本.py
import os

libs = {
     "numpy", "matplotlib", "pillow", "sklearn", "requests", \
        "jieba", "beautifulsoup4", "wheel", "networkx", "sympy", \
        "pyinstaller", "django", "flask", "werobot", "pyqt5", \
        "pandas", "pyopengl", "pypdf2", "docopt", "pygame"}

try:
    for lib in libs:
        os.system("pip install " + lib)
        print(lib + "install successful")
    print("All Successful")
except:
    print("Failed Somehow")

注:本文是博主本人学习的日常记录,不进行任何商用所以不支持转载请理解!如果你也对Python有一定的兴趣和理解,欢迎随时找博主交流~

你可能感兴趣的:(我的Python学习之路,python,脚本语言,shell)